Omnicom Media has announced the appointment of Ellen Griffin as Global Brand President of OMD.
In her new role, Griffin, who most recently served as the agency’s President, Global Chief Operating Officer, will oversee strategy, capabilities and service solutions for OMD globally. The mandate includes ensuring that teams across markets are equipped with the tools, talent and technology required to drive growth for clients and the network.
She succeeds George Manas, who has moved to Omnicom as Chief Growth and Solutions Officer.
“George has been an exceptional steward of the OMD brand over the past four years,” said Florian Adamski, CEO of Omnicom Media. “Under his leadership, OMD significantly advanced its position as the world’s best performing media agency, leading the Research Company Evaluating Media Agencies (RECMA) to describe OMD as “more than ever the leader” in its latest Diagnostic Report.
During his tenure, OMD was named Media Network of the Year at Cannes three times, including consecutive wins in 2024 and 2025. This remarkable record reflects both the strength of the agency and George’s ability to drive collaboration among teams around the world – a talent that will serve him well in his new role.”
Griffin joined the agency in 2018 as Global Innovation Director.

Griffin’s appointment is effective immediately.
